Legal Requirements & Penalties in MN
Minnesota law mandates workers' compensation coverage for most businesses with employees. Failure to comply can result in fines up to $5,000 per violation and potential civil penalties. The system operates on a no-fault basis, providing benefits for work-related injuries.

Industry Risk Factors & Class Codes
Premiums are based on classification codes assigned to job roles. High-risk industries like agriculture pay more than low-risk ones like office work. Keeping accurate records helps reduce costs.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does workers compensation insurance cover?
It covers medical expenses, lost wages, and rehabilitation for employees injured at work, as well as liability protection for employers.
Is workers compensation required in Madison Lake?
Yes, just like the rest of MN, employers in Madison Lake must provide coverage or face fines and penalties.
